This well-illustrated compendium of recent works in social psychiatry from around the world describes the association between cultural elements indigenous to a society and mental health and illness. The book compares this anthropologic-descriptive body of work with highly quantitative research papers that emphasize the notion of stratification. A discussion of directions for future cross-cultural investigations integrating culturalist and universalist approaches concludes the text.
